Weather Underground Forecast for Friday, May 25, 2012.

Expect more active weather to develop across the Great Lakes on Friday, as a low pressure system moves from the Upper Midwest into eastern Canada. This system will push a cold front over the Great Lakes and Midwest, producing scattered showers and thunderstorms throughout the day. There is a slight chance that some of these storms will turn severe with strong winds and large hail. Rainfall totals will range from 1 to 2 inches, with over 2 inches likely in areas of severe weather development.

Behind this activity in the West, a low pressure system will move over the Great Basin and into the Southern Rockies. Flow around this system will produce cooler temperatures across the West, while also triggering scattered showers over the Pacific Northwest, northern California, and Intermountain West. Snow showers may develop again across the highest elevations of the Northern Rockies.

Meanwhile in the East, high pressure builds from the Plains, over the Mississippi River Valley, and into the Eastern US. This will keep moisture away to the north, allowing for dry, sunny, and warm conditions. High temperatures will range in the 80s and 90s from the Central Plains through the Eastern Valleys, with parts of the Southern US reaching into the lower 100s.

Winter Weather Advisory
Mobile & Email Alerts Statement as of 6:40 AM PDT on May 25, 2012

... Winter Weather Advisory remains in effect until 6 PM PDT this
evening above 6000 feet...

* snow accumulations: 2 to 6 inches above 6000 feet... locally as
much as 8 inches over the highest terrain... through Friday
evening.

* Elevation: above 6000 feet.

* Timing: snow showers are expected to increase over the High
Sierra today... and continue into Friday evening.

* Locations include: the Lassen park area... the major trans-Sierra
passes including Interstate 80... and Highway 50.

* Winds: no significantly strong winds today.

* Impacts: colder temperatures... periods of wet snow.

Precautionary/preparedness actions...

A Winter Weather Advisory for snow means that periods of snow
will cause primarily travel difficulties. Be prepared for snow
covered roads and limited visibilities... and use caution while
driving.
